Peach, Honey, Thyme, Goat Cheese, and Cinnamon Frittata
This frittata takes on a nice flavor from the ground cinnamon and honey in this recipe. This is a good dish to make when fresh peaches are in season and at their peak
Serves 4
Ingredients
4 thin slices of a yellow peach
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on granulated sugar
1/4 cup wildflower honey
1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ves , plus additional for garnish
1/8 cup plain goat cheese , crumbled
6 large eggs
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350°F.
Whisk the eggs together in a medium bowl. Add the cinnamon, sugar, and honey to the bowl. Stir until combined.
Heat the olive oil in a medium c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add the eggs to the pan and cook for 4 minutes. Arrange the peaches over the top and sprinkle with the thyme and goat cheese. Place in the oven and bake for 20 to 25 minutes. Remove from the oven.
Slice into wedges and serve immediately.
